At 18, while working in a Gospel Mission in Washington DC, a drunk… in for his 3 days a month stay in one of our rooms, quoted a few lines of Omar’s work to me and I went directly to the library the next day and got a copy of E, Fitzgerald’s translation (the only one worth reading and the same with Witter Bynner and his Lao Tzu) and then also discovered a recording of Lord Alfred Drake reading it and then in a couple of weeks or so, I memorized the whole thing. As I remember, there was something like 114 quatrains of four lines each… well, that would be a quatrain. I don’t remember it all any more- consciously …but that is no longer important either. It is not the details of what educated you that counts. It is the depth of the impact. I memorized all kinds of things I no longer remember and they didn’t have the same impact… at all.
